  • Docker(5):Docker镜像基本操作(上)

    1、获取镜像

    可以使用docker pull 命令从网络上下载镜像。该命令的格式为docker pull NAME[:TAG]。对于Docker镜像来说,如果不显示地指定TAG,则默认会选择latest标签,即下载仓库中最新版本的镜像。

    从Docker Hub的hello-world仓库下载一个最新的镜像:

    1 [root@localhost ~]# docker pull hello-world
    2 Using default tag: latest
    3 latest: Pulling from library/hello-world
    4 1b930d010525: Pull complete 
    5 Digest: sha256:92695bc579f31df7a63da6922075d0666e565ceccad16b59c3374d2cf4e8e50e
    6 Status: Downloaded newer image for hello-world:latest

    也可以通过指定标签来下载特定版本的某一个镜像:

    # docker pull ubuntu: 14.04

    则会从仓库下载14.04版本的镜像。

    也可以选择从其他注册服务器的仓库下载。此时,需要在仓库名称前指定完整的仓库注册服务器的地址。例如从DockerPool社区的镜像源dl.dockerpool.com下载最新的Ubuntu镜像:

    # docker pull dl.dockerpool.com:5000/ubuntu

    下载镜像到本地后,即可随时使用该镜像了。

    2、 查看镜像信息

    使用docker images命令可以列出本地主机已有的镜像。

    1 [root@localhost ~]# docker images
    2 REPOSITORY          TAG                 IMAGE ID            CREATED             SIZE
    3 hello-world         latest              fce289e99eb9        4 months ago        1.84kB

    该信息中列出了镜像来自哪个仓库,镜像的标签信息,镜像的ID号(唯一),创建时间,镜像大小。

    其中镜像的ID信息非常重要,它唯一标识了镜像

    TAG信息用于标记来自同一个仓库的不同镜像。例如Ubuntu仓库中有多个镜像,通过TAG信息来区分发布版本,包括10.04、12.04、12.10、13.04、14.04等标签。

    使用docker inspect命令可以获取该镜像的详细信息:

    docker inspect命令返回的是一个JSON格式的数据,如果我们只要其中一项内容时,可以使用-f参数来指定,例如,获取镜像的Architecture信息:

    [root@localhost ~]# docker inspect -f {{".Architecture"}} fce2
    
    amd64

    注:在指定镜像ID时,通常可以使用该ID的前若干个字符组成的可区分字串来替代完整的ID。

    3. 搜索镜像

    使用docker search 命令可以搜索远端仓库中的共享的镜像,默认搜索Docker Hub官方仓库中的镜像。用法为docker search TERM,支持的参数包括:

    • --automated=false 仅显示自动创建的镜像
    • --no—trunc=false 输出信息不截断显示
    • -s,--stars=0 指定仅显示评价为指定星级以上的镜像

    例:搜索带MySQL关键字的镜像:

    返回信息中包括镜像名字、描述、星级、是否为官方创建、是否自动创建。

    默认的输出结果将按照星级评价进行排序。

    4. 删除镜像

    使用docker rmi 命令可以删除镜像,命令格式为docker rmi IMAGE[IMAGE…],其中IMAGE可以为标签或ID。

    注:当有该镜像创建的容器存在时,镜像文件默认是无法删除的。如果要想强行删除镜像,可以使用 –f 参数:

    # docker rmi –f Ubuntu
